> Decapoda (Lobster, shrimp and crabs) > Crangonidae (crangonid shrimps)

Environment: milieu / climate zone / depth range / distribution range Écologie

; profondeur 20 - 1550 m (Ref. 104052), usually 200 - 400 m (Ref. 106485).   Temperate; 73°N - 30°N, 16°W - 30°E

Distribution Pays | Zones FAO | Écosystèmes | Occurrences | Introductions

Eastern Atlantic and the Mediterranean.

Length at first maturity / Taille / Poids / Âge

Maturity: Lm ?  range ? - ? cm Max length : 5.2 cm TL mâle / non sexé; (Ref. 104052)

Biologie     Glossaire (ex. epibenthic)

Benthic (Ref. 78235). Epibenthic (Ref. 87524). Benthopelagic (Ref. 79199). Found on the continental shelf (Ref. 105470) and upper slope (Ref. 78235). Benthos feeder (Ref. 107006).

Life cycle and mating behavior Maturité | Reproduction | Frai | Œufs | Fécondité | Larves

Members of the order Decapoda are mostly gonochoric. Mating behavior: Precopulatory courtship ritual is common (through olfactory and tactile cues); usually indirect sperm transfer.
